Why made to measure?

The benefits of a made to measure bicycle is that the bicycle fits your individual physiology – a perfect fit! You can achieve a ‘no compromise’ fit where parts have to be ‘tweaked’ as generally happens on a standard ‘off the peg’ bicycle.

What’s the benefit of hand made bicycles?

Hand made gives you control over the construction process. You can dictate the desired engineering outcome at an individual level which isn’t feasible compared to a mass produced item.

What is the process and how do I start?

Book in for an appointment to see us – we need to discover ‘you’ – your aspirations, your tastes, how much you’d like to allocate out of your budget on the purchase. We can then start the process of showing you the options to create your bicycle.


Once you are comfortable on a decision to proceed, we commence the bike fitting stage. From this we will develop the frame design.

When the design has been approved from the factory and you have confirmed your bicycle choice, we request a payment deposit from you to proceed to the construction phase.

From this point onwards it is in our hands – we will have the bicycle built and shipped to the UK and built to your specification. Your next point of contact will be to collect your bicycle from ourselves and complete the purchase.
